11 Key Points About Colin Allred's Senate Campaign

1. Who is Colin Allred?

Colin Allred is a Democratic congressman representing Texas's 32nd congressional district. He is currently running for the U.S. Senate seat against Republican incumbent Ted Cruz.

2. What is the significance of Allred's bipartisan record?

Allred has been recognized as the most bipartisan member of the Texas Congressional Delegation. He has supported over 70% of legislation with bipartisan support, including measures like the CHIPS and Science Act, the Bipartisan Safer Communities Act, and the Bipartisan Infrastructure Law.

3. Who are some of the prominent Republicans supporting Allred?

Allred has garnered support from several prominent Republicans, including former Congressman Adam Kinzinger, former State Rep. Jason Villalba, and former Congressman Steve Bartlett. These endorsements highlight Allred's ability to bridge party lines and appeal to a broader audience.

4. How is Allred's campaign performing in polls?

Allred has made significant progress in polls, narrowing the gap with Ted Cruz. He has even pulled ahead in some statewide polls, indicating a strong challenge to Cruz's re-election bid.

5. What are some of the key issues Allred is focusing on in his campaign?

Allred's campaign is centered around kitchen table issues important to Texans, such as supporting veterans, strengthening national security, and addressing economic concerns. He has also championed legislation like the Skills Against Violence Act to support survivors of gender-based violence.

6. How is Allred's fundraising compared to Cruz's?

Allred has consistently outraised Cruz, bringing in over $1 million in a single day during the third quarter. By the end of the second quarter, Allred had raised more than $14 million compared to Cruz's campaign and associated PACs.

7. What is the significance of the Republicans for Allred coalition?

The Republicans for Allred coalition, co-chaired by former State Rep. Jason Villalba and former Congressman Adam Kinzinger, underscores Allred's ability to attract support from across the political spectrum. This coalition includes former Congressmen and state representatives who believe in Allred's commitment to serving Texans.

8. How is Allred's campaign strategy different from other Democratic candidates?

Allred's campaign strategy is more traditional and focused on targeted ads and moderate policy. Unlike some other Democratic candidates, Allred has kept a distance from national figures like Kamala Harris, focusing instead on local issues and building a grassroots movement.

9. What endorsements has Allred received?

Allred has received endorsements from prominent figures such as former U.S. Reps. Liz Cheney and Adam Kinzinger, as well as U.S. Sen. Bernie Sanders and U.S.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ez. These endorsements highlight his bipartisan appeal and strong support within the Democratic Party.

10. What are the challenges facing Allred in his campaign?

Despite his progress, Allred still faces significant challenges. He is running against a well-funded incumbent in a state that hasn't elected a Democrat to statewide office in over 20 years. Additionally, Cruz's strong support among Texas conservatives and his ability to tie Allred to national Democratic policies pose ongoing challenges.

11. What is the upcoming debate between Allred and Cruz?

The first debate between Allred and Cruz is scheduled for October 15. This debate will be a crucial moment in the campaign, allowing voters to see the candidates' direct interactions and hear their responses to key issues.
